I figured out that i had Oculus Home 2.0 Beta enabled , as soon as i opted out my Win 10 Display options went from having 2 screens to showing nothing , just the way i remember it being in all other VR title .
Now i was getting very close to 90 Avg but was still not smooth so i tried Alt Tab and Presto ! solid smooth 89.9 - 91 with 200% SS in Steam , AA x 4 and all on Full except for reflections and particles .

All those having stutters try Alt Tab and for VR users with stutters , have a look and see if you have opted into Oculus Home Beta 2.0 and opt out if so .

For VR users especially Oculus Rift users, it is important that you not have Oculus home running in the background. All you need to do is fire up steam and then steam VR to run rfactor2 in VR. Having Oculus home running in the background seems to significantly decrease smoothness and frames per second. At least for me.
